**PR: add bloom filter ahead of Cellarmap reads**

Cuts pointless disk lookups for absent keys. Filter is rebuilt on compaction; stale bits only cause false positives, never misses. Memory cost is fixed per shard. Reviewer: check the sizing math against expected key counts. The filter parameters chosen for this rollout are below.

constants for tajep-kahag:
RATE_LIMITS = {
    "oliath": 1,
    "druael": 10,
}

Runbook — Vellum template rendering slowness. If p95 render time exceeds two seconds, first check the partial cache hit rate; cold caches after deploys are the usual cause. Avoid raising worker counts before confirming cache behavior, as that historically made GC pauses worse. Warm the cache via the admin task. The renderer's current tuning values are listed below.

config for kafof-bawef:
holath:
  log_level: debug
  metrics_host: metrics.holath.qorvelsys.internal
  pin: 2191
  pool_size: 32

## Break-Glass Access: PointsPerch Ledger

Hey plugin authors — normally you only touch the PointsPerch loyalty ledger through the sandbox API. If the sandbox is down and you're blocking a launch, break-glass access exists, but it's logged and reviewed by the Larkspur team, so use it sparingly. Unlock the emergency console from the partner portal, then enter the recovery passphrase shown here:

unlock words, kadug-tahog: casax-holath